Portretul lui Constantin C. Cornescu (1830 – 1900)

Portretul lui Constantin C. Cornescu (1830 – 1900) is an unspecified painting by the Biedermeier artist Constantin Daniel Rosenthal. It dates from 1848 and is held in the collection of the National Museum of Art of Romania.

Artist
Constantin Daniel Rosenthal (b.Rosenthal Konstantin, 1820 – July 23, 1851) was a painter and sculptor of Austrian birth and a Romanian 1848 revolutionary, best known for his portraits and his choice of Romanian Romantic nationalist…
